Ostepathy & Cranial Osteopathy

Osteopathy is a system of diagnosis and treatment which lays its’ main emphasis on the structural integrity of the body. Although best know as a treatment for bad backs and painful muscles and joints, it can in fact be used to treat a wide variety of illness. An osteopath assesses a patient from a mechanical, functional and structural standpoint and then uses a variety of manipulative techniques to return the functions to normal

Cranial Osteopathy (or Craniosacral Therapy) is a specialized area of osteopathy which uses the rhythmic pulse of the cerebrospinal fluid for diagnosis and treatments. It is a particularly gentle technique and therefore most suitable for babies, pregnant woman and others of similarly sensitive disposition

Acupuncture

Acupuncture is an ancient Chinese healing system which is used to treat people with a wide range of illnesses. In addition to treating specific symptoms connected to the various physical and psychological conditions it can also be used to improve the overall well being of a patient and thus act as a preventative measure against further illnesses.

Very fine (and painless) needles are inserted into various acupuncture points which can stimulate the body’s own healing response and help to restore its natural balance. This has also been shown to cause the release of our own natural pain killers, endorphin and serotonin
